Vapor Barrier Installation Questions
What is a vapor barrier? A vapor barrier is a material installed to prevent moisture from passing through walls or floors, helping to reduce mold and structural damage.
Where should vapor barriers be installed? Vapor barriers are typically installed in crawl spaces, basements, or underneath concrete slabs to control moisture levels.
What materials are used for vapor barrier installation? Common materials include polyethylene plastic sheets, usually 6 mils or thicker, designed to resist moisture passage.
Why is vapor barrier installation important? Proper installation helps prevent excess moisture, reducing the risk of mold growth and structural issues in buildings.
